Output ed82f71e95484c8d08303513de60e2bea1634d3c93fe410a6681fa0b7eaf2c32:1

value
39366410
script pubkey
OP_0 OP_PUSHBYTES_20 621cf0e68f5c37436ba27ac0010fa35381012053
address
bc1qvgw0pe50tsm5x6az0tqqzrar2wqszgznx6pxe6
transaction
ed82f71e95484c8d08303513de60e2bea1634d3c93fe410a6681fa0b7eaf2c32
confirmations
62
spent
false